Abstract

Teknologi dengan implementasi smart sistem ini akan mampu menunjang untuk meningkatkan dan mampu untuk menciptakan kehandalan serta efesiensi pada sistem pembangkit maupun distribusi daya listrik. Alat ini dapat beroperasi secara otomatis untuk menghentikan aliran energi listrik pada saat waktu istirahat dan informasinya disampaikan kepada pengelola gedung secara mobile. Hasil pengukuran SiSCE apabila aliran listrik tidak dimatikan selama waktu istirahat menunjukan konsumsi energi listrik pada saat istirahat hampir mencapai setengah lebih tinggi dibandingkan dengan jam operasional kegiatan perkantoran. Teknologi ini juga bisa membantu mempercepat proses elektrifikasi di Indonesia. Dengan tujuan melakukan penghematan konsumsi pada suatu energi listrik, untuk mengontrol penggunaan energi listrik tersebut maka dilakukan pengembangan suatu sistem smart control energi dengan menerapkan teknologi Wireless Sensor Network (WSN) dan Internet of Thing (IoT) yang mana bisadapat mewujudkan Smart Office hemat energi untuk mendukung Smart City (SC) di Era Industri sekarang ini, Pengujian Sistem Smart Control Energi (SiSCE) dilakukan di Laboratorium Sekolah SMK.

Abstract

Industry is a sector that requires special attention regarding worker safety. To increase the level of safety, the use of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) connected to sensors is an innovative smart solution. By utilizing Internet of Things technology, the PPE system can provide real-time information regarding worker conditions and the work environment. Worker helmets are equipped with LDR sensors, which function to provide warnings to workers who are not wearing helmets and send information to the field supervision center via the Telegram application These sensors confirm the presence of workers and provide information about their activities. The LDR sensors are connected to a central monitoring system that enables real-time monitoring and rapid response to workers who are not wearing PPE helmets. This solution not only provides maximum protection against the risk of accidents, but also increases efficiency in safety management in industry. With automatic notifications and connection to a central system, this solution is a proactive step towards a safer and more efficient work environment in the industrial sector.

Abstract

With the growing controlled system used in small industries and big industries which was originally used hard wired into Programable Logic Controller requires the students know and understand about PLC because, PLC makes it easy for user to change a system without changing the electrical circuit. The author believes that the focus of learning the philosophy of making a control system does not have to depend on a particular PLC brand. Therefore in this final project the authors designed a Sequential Conveyor Simulator. Control system is intended to control the on/off conveyor and find out how much power needed to drive the conveyor. In the control system, there are three digital inputs are sourced from the push button, sensor, and limit switch while output in the form of on/off conveyor motors. The series consists hardware and software that connect the two using a simple wiring. From the test result show the hardware and software in accordance with the design controll proces, the average power needed to move the conveyor is 13,077 watt.
